Paranoia is a mental disordercharacter. It is accompanied by some delirious ideas that develop in the mind of the patient. He does not trust his relatives, friends and relatives. The paranoiac reacts very sharply to this or that behavior of people, categorically does not accept in his address any criticism. Including, he never admits that he has a paranoia. This formation of delusional thoughts is closely related to the character and personality of the patient. The fact is that the paranoid raves not because he incorrectly regards the world around him, but for the simple reason that he has a pronounced inner conflict with himself.

The main sign of potential paranoia ishis delusional ideas, which are always based on distrust of others, on a suspicious attitude towards them. Paranoid misinterprets any situation, giving different meaningless little things to great importance. For such people it is peculiar to exaggerate everything and to paint in negative colors. For example, a paranoid suffering from delusions of persecution will easily suspect that his enemy, a maniac or a terrorist is looking askance at him! Or, for example, a spouse, suffering from a delirium of jealousy, "bring to the handle" his wife, making constant scandals about any of her delays at work. The saddest thing about all this is that no proofs and reasonable arguments that refute the patient's delusional ideas have no power for him. He just will not accept them!

Many believe that both of these mentaldisorders are one and the same. This is not true. Patients with paranoia are overwhelmed by some unreasonable criticism of the entire surrounding world. At the same time, they do not accept criticism for their own sake for their own sake. As they say, "everything in the world is bad, and you are alone - wonderful!" They do not have visual and auditory hallucinations, as in schizophrenics. Moreover, paranoids are not subject to any phantasmagoric ideas, which can not be said about schizophrenics. However, sometimes both diseases can complement each other, for example, with the diagnosis of "paranoid schizophrenia."

The whole logic of a man who is paranoid,is built on his own conclusions. And in fact an adequate person to find a "gap" in this is almost impossible! It seems that everything in the patient is logical. But not the initial links of his "paranoid" chain, on the basis of which a false conclusion is built.
